the U.S. Senate produced a bipartisan bill on sanctions against functionaries of the Communist party of China and Chinese organizations that are involved in the preparation and implementation of a new system of laws in Hong Kong. About this newspaper the Wall Street Journal.

democratic Senator Chris van HOLLEN and his Republican colleague Pat Toomey found another reason to impose sanctions against China, saying that already worked on introducing a bill on sanctions. However, the information about the new bill, the PRC forced them to operate more actively.

As indicated by the policy, they intend to convince the leaders of the Senate to consider this issue. “We will punish those involved in illegal punitive measures of China in Hong Kong,” said van HOLLEN.

According to the law of 1992, the U.S. supports separate from China and more favourable trade regime with Hong Kong but only if Washington sees that this administrative region maintains a high degree of autonomy from Beijing.

the USA argued that any decisions that affect the autonomy and freedom of Hong Kong “an inevitable impact” on the assessment of the Washington agreement of “One country, two systems” and the status of the territory. Beijing rejects criticism of the United States.

the Resolution on the drafting of a law on the mechanism for the protection of national security in Hong Kong is included in the agenda of the 3rd session of vsekitajsky meeting of national representatives of the 13th convocation. Lawmakers intend to consider the development of a bill on the establishment and improvement of legal system and enforcement mechanism for the protection of national security in Hong Kong.

Hong Kong returned to China in 1997. According to the joint Declaration of China and Hong Kong was promised broad autonomy for 50 years. Due to this status in Hong Kong enjoyed a special relationship with the United States.
